The Adamawa State Police Command has called for public assistance in locating the family of Hamza Abdullahi, a boy estimated to be around 12 years old, who was found on Saturday, June 29, 2025, in Song Local Government Area of the state.
SP Suleiman Yahaya Nguroje, Police Public Relations Officer i n the state, in a statement shared on the official social media page of the command, said Hamza was discovered by a Good Samaritan near an internally displaced persons (IDP) camp in Song and taken to the Divisional Police Headquarters.
The boy identified himself as a resident of Dokoro Village in Dukku Local Government Area, Gombe State.
Commissioner of Police, CP Dankombo Morris, expressed concern about what he described as parental negligence, noting that such lapses expose children to danger and exploitation.
The police are appealing to members of the public, especially residents of Gombe and Adamawa states, to assist in tracing the child’s parents or guardians.
